"Everyone in Lark’s End thinks Vera Calloway is a sweet old woman with a knitting bag, a fondness for tea, and an overfed cat named Watson. Everyone is wrong. When Major Barnaby collapses face-first into his prize petunias at the village fête, the police see a tragic heart attack. Vera sees a professional hit. And after forty years in the Service, she knows the difference. Now someone is buying up village land, blackmailing locals, and eliminating obstacles. Vera should leave it to the authorities. Unfortunately, the authorities are useless. Armed with knitting needles, spycraft, and one deeply judgmental ginger tabby, Vera sets out to save Lark’s End before the killer strikes again. Retired spy? Perhaps. Finished? Not even close."

"Four senior sleuths. One missing pumpkin. Zero chance of keeping out of trouble. When Brenda Mossberry’s prize-winning pumpkin vanishes days before the annual fair, she hires The Brrok Ridge Falls Ladies Detective Agency to track down the thief. Armed with Mona's keen sleuthing skills, Ida’s improbable statistics, Ruth’s questionable “evasive driving,” and Helen’s sharp reporter’s instincts, the ladies chase tire tracks, snoop through barns, and stir up plenty of small-town gossip. But the deeper they dig, the stranger the case becomes. Full of humor, friendship, and fall festival fun, The Case of the Missing Pumpkin is a cozy caper that proves you’re never too old to solve a mystery… or to stir up a little mischief along the way."

"When Rodney Hart is found dead and his prized turkeys on the loose just days before Brooke Ridge Falls' Thanksgiving festivities, Lexy Baker and her band of spirited senior sleuths are on the case. While the turkeys are relishing their newfound freedom, Lexy, Nans and the gang are busy nosing around town to figure out who had a motive to kill Rodney. From the town hall employee in charge of the annual Thanksgiving feast who has something to hide, to the competing farmer who wanted everyone to switch to ham to a very angry animal rights activist, Lexy and the ladies don’t know who has the most compelling motive. In order to narrow the list, Lexy and the team come up with an ingenious plan to lure the killer into a trap. The only question is... will it backfire?"
